
Warsaw Chopin Airport EPWA / WAW
Poland's main airport, only 20 minutes from the Warsaw business district, with a GA terminal and CIQ on the south side. Night ban and slot coordination apply; government and NATO-related VIP traffic can occupy the apron.

An FBO is the private terminal: lounge, crew, fuel, customs desk. You drive up, walk 30 metres, and board.
